  • f2tornadof2tornado Posts: 180 ✭✭
    1950's: 1952 (1953 and 1955 a close race for second)
    1960's: 1960 (just beautiful but followed up by the the uggliest vintage Topps set in 1961)
    1970's: 1972 (but practically a tie with the 1971 black beauties)
    1980's: 1982 (Always liked this set in an otherwise pland period of Topps cards)
    1990's: 1995 (the limited use of gold foil added a nice touch)
    2000's: 2005 (but the 2007 black border set with take the slot when it comes out soon)

    Blidflyer's pic of the 1960 Killebrew reminded me of how nice that set is. I am putting together Topps Twins sets back to the initial team in 1961 but am gonna have to add the 1960 Senators team to the mix. Love that set.
